**Kylebooker Fly Fishing Chest Waders: A Budget-Friendly Choice for Anglers?**

For fly fishing enthusiasts, investing in reliable chest waders is essential for comfort and performance on the water. The **Kylebooker Fly Fishing Chest Waders Breathable Waterproof Stocking Foot River Wader Pants** have gained attention as an affordable option, but how do they stack up in terms of value for money? This review examines their features, durability, and overall性价比 (cost-performance ratio) to help you decide if they’re worth adding to your gear collection.

### **Key Features**
1. **Breathability & Waterproofing**
These waders are marketed as both breathable and waterproof, thanks to a multi-layer fabric design. While they may not match the premium breathability of high-end brands like Simms or Patagonia, they perform adequately for casual or occasional use. The waterproof seams and reinforced knees add durability, though prolonged exposure to heavy rain or rough terrain may test their limits.

2. **Stocking Foot Design**
The stocking foot style allows anglers to pair the waders with separate wading boots for better fit and traction. This flexibility is a plus, but ensure your boots are compatible and provide ample support.

3. **Adjustable Fit**
With adjustable suspenders and a chest-high design, the waders accommodate various body types. However, some users report sizing discrepancies—consider checking the size chart carefully or ordering a size up for layering in colder conditions.

4. **Pocket & D-Ring Utility**
The chest pocket and D-rings offer convenient storage for fly boxes, tools, or accessories, though the pocket’s waterproofing isn’t guaranteed.

### **Pros & Cons**
**Pros:**
– **Affordable:** Priced significantly lower than premium brands.
– **Lightweight:** Comfortable for long fishing sessions.
– **Decent Waterproofing:** Suitable for moderate conditions.

**Cons:**
– **Durability Concerns:** Thin material may wear faster in abrasive environments.
– **Limited Breathability:** Can feel clammy in hot weather.
– **Sizing Issues:** Inconsistent fit reported by some buyers.

### **性价比 (Cost-Performance) Verdict**
The **Kylebooker waders** excel as an entry-level or backup option for anglers on a budget. While they lack the ruggedness of $500+ waders, their price-to-performance ratio is reasonable for beginners or those fishing in calm rivers. If you prioritize long-term durability or extreme conditions, investing in a premium brand may be wiser. However, for occasional use or as a spare pair, these waders offer solid functionality without breaking the bank.
